Cerebellum-mediated trainability of eye and head movements for dynamic gazing.

Akiyoshi MatsugiNaoki YoshidaSatoru NishishitaYohei OkadaNobuhiko MoriKosuke OkuShinya DouchiKoichi HosomiYouichi Saitoh
Published in: PloS one (2019)
GSEs can modulate eye movements with respect to head movements, and the cerebellum may be associated with eye-head coordination trainability for dynamic gazing during head movements.
